Job description

Job Overview

Located in Newman, Western Australia, this full-time FIFO position reports directly to the Branch Manager and is based onsite at a customer location. The Storeperson will be primarily responsible for hose building, accurately and efficiently interpreting parts, and managing the picking, packing, and dispatch of customer parts orders. Comprehensive hose building training will be provided to support this role.

About Newman Team

The Newman-based team delivers Cat machinery services tailored to various earthmoving operations, covering new and used equipment sales, heavy equipment rentals, parts provisioning, servicing, and merchandise sales.

Work Schedule

The roster follows an 8 days on, 6 days off cycle, with 12-hour workdays including a meal break.

About WesTrac

WesTrac is one of the largest authorized Cat® equipment dealers globally, employing over 4,500 staff and offering extensive mining and construction machinery products and solutions.
